Controls Programmer (Level II or III) – Building Automation – Dallas, TX (Hybrid)
About the Role:
A well-established building automation contractor is seeking a skilled Controls Programmer to support projects throughout the Dallas metro. This position is ideal for BAS professionals who want a hybrid schedule (60% remote / 40% field) and enjoy taking full ownership of programming, integration, and commissioning tasks.
Most work is centered around municipal and K-12 facilities, offering steady project flow and a collaborative technical environment. If you have a passion for controls integration, energy-efficient system design, and hands-on commissioning, this is a strong opportunity to move into a growing, supportive team.
- Title: Controls Programmer
- Schedule: Hybrid (60% home, 40% field)
- Territory: Primarily Dallas area with minimal travel outside the metro
- Develop and customize BAS programs and front-end user graphics from the ground up
- Visit job sites for commissioning, troubleshooting, and customer support
- Interpret project specifications, drawings, and system requirements
- Create, configure, and validate databases, logic sequences, and control algorithms
- Work closely with installation crews and project engineering teams for seamless execution
- Perform point-to-point checkout, functional testing, and final commissioning activities
- Verify system performance and ensure programming meets quality and compliance expectations
- 3+ years of experience in BAS programming, integration, or similar controls role
- Strong understanding of BACnet networks, protocols, and device communication
- Ability to diagnose issues within software, hardware, or field-level integrations
- Comfortable reading mechanical/electrical drawings and interpreting control designs
-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ance (premium plan options)
- 401(k) with company match
- 15 days PTO in the first year + 9 paid holidays
- Tools provided: laptop, cell phone, gas card, and field equipment
- Clear path for advancement into senior programming or project leadership roles
